Paslode Framing Nailer Repair: A Comprehensive Guide

1. Identifying the Issue:

Before embarking on any repair, it’s essential to diagnose the problem with your Paslode framing nailer. Common issues include:

  • Firing Problems: The nailer may misfire, fail to fire, or double-fire nails.

  • Air Leaks: Air leaks can result in weak or inconsistent nail firing.

  • Jamming: Nails may become jammed in the nailer’s magazine or firing mechanism.

  • Lack of Power: The nailer may not sink nails properly or consistently.

2. Tools and Materials:

To perform Paslode framing nailer repair, you’ll need the following tools and materials:

  • Screwdrivers (Phillips and flathead): For disassembly and reassembly.

  • Wrenches: For removing and tightening components.

  • Replacement Parts: Depending on the issue, you may need replacement O-rings, seals, or other components.

  • Lubricating Oil: For proper maintenance and lubrication.

3. Disassembly:

Carefully disassemble the nailer, ensuring you keep track of each component you remove. Refer to your Paslode manual for guidance on the disassembly process, as it may vary by model.

4. Troubleshooting and Repair:

a. Firing Problems: If your nailer misfires or fails to fire, the issue might be related to the fuel cell or battery. Check these components for proper installation and condition. Also, inspect the spark plug and replace it if necessary.

b. Air Leaks: Air leaks often occur due to worn O-rings or seals. Replace these components to resolve the issue. Ensure all connections are tight.

c. Jamming: Clear any jammed nails from the magazine, and inspect for damage to the firing mechanism. Lubricate moving parts to prevent future jams.

d. Lack of Power: If your nailer lacks the power to sink nails, inspect the depth adjustment setting. Make sure it’s properly adjusted to your material. Check the fuel cell or battery for sufficient charge.

5. Reassembly:

Reassemble your nailer in the reverse order of disassembly, ensuring all components are properly aligned and tightened. Refer to your manual for guidance.

6. Testing:

After reassembly, test your Paslode framing nailer by firing a few nails. Ensure it operates smoothly and effectively.

7. Maintenance:

Regular maintenance is crucial for preventing future issues. Clean and lubricate your nailer as recommended in the manual. This will prolong its lifespan and maintain its performance.
